Germander

Speedwell

Veronica

chamaedrys

The numerous

different

speedwells are in

the Veronicaceae

family. The leaves

are always serrated

or at least finely

toothed and the

flowers 4-petalled.

In this species the

stems have a

double row of hairs

like ‘cowboy

trousers’ and the

flowers are a

bright, deep-blue.

Very common in

grasslands.
